#e4410c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#e4410c is composed of 89.4% red, 25.5% green and 4.7%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 71.5% magenta, 94.7% yellow and 10.6% black. It has a hue angle of 14.7 degrees, a saturation of 90% and a lightness of 47.1%. #e4410c color hex could be obtained by blending #ff8218 with #c90000. Closest websafe color is: #cc3300.

#e4410c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#e4410c has RGB values of R:228, G:65, B:12 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.71, Y:0.95, K:0.11. Its decimal value is 14958860.

Shades and Tints of #e4410c
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#040100 is the darkest color, while #fef4f1 is the lightest one.

Tones of #e4410c
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#7e7572 is the less saturated color, while #ed3c03 is the most saturated one.
